Ipoh is the capital of Perak. Before 1880, Ipoh was only a village in Malaysia. After 1880, the city gained popularity when tin deposits were discovered. Declared as a city in 1988, Ipoh boasts a rich history and culture. One can still witness the British-era architectural elements by taking a walk across Ipoh.
The major tourist attractions here are heritage buildings, recreational parks, cave temples, restaurants that offer delicious local and Malaysian delicacies. Ipoh is known as the Gateway to Cameron Highlands, one of Malaysia's most popular tourist destinations. The city is also known for being a major transportation hub in Malaysia.
Penang is the northwest state of Malaysia, located on the coast. It is often referred to as The Island of Pearl or the Pearl of the Orient. The place has various heritage buildings from the British colonial era. Most of the architecture here is influenced by the British, Indians, and Chinese.
It also has some dramatic landscapes and beautiful beaches where you can enjoy nature. Street art is also one of the major tourist attractions where people take pictures against some realistic art on the walls.
Apart from tourism and history, the state is also known for its educational standards. Penang has a staggering youth literacy rate of more than 95%. Apart from tourism purposes, many people visit the state for occupational and business reasons. The manufacturing, services, and tourism industry of Penang generate many jobs.

The average temperature in Penang throughout the year is around 30-32 degrees. The hottest month is February, and the coldest is September. October gets the maximum rainfall here. January is the driest and the sunniest month of the year.

There are several options for getting around Penang. First, you have got city buses that take you to all the major attractions in the city. There are monorail, taxis, and rental cars as well. Motorbike rentals are another option suitable for couples and solo travellers to get around. Trishaws are also widely seen in and around the place.
The Chinese New Year celebrations in February at Penang attract many visitors from all parts of the nation. National Day and Malaysia Day celebrations in Penang also attract many visitors in August and September. Other festivals in the state that attract tourists are Thaipusam, King’s Birthday, Deepavali, Christmas, and Prophet Muhammad’s Birthday. The Chingay Parade in February also attracts many tourists to Penang. It is an annual street parade that celebrates the Chinese gods/goddesses.
